REPORT: Carbon monoxide killed American visitors
The American tourists who were found dead in villas at Sandals Emerald Bay resort on Exuma earlier this month, died from carbon monoxide poisoning, The Nassau Guardian understands. The pathologist is expected to release the findings of the autopsy and toxicology report today.
Dona Bertarelli unveils an ultra-luxury boutique resort for Exumas Cays, the Bahamas
The low-rise, low-density, environmentally sensitive resort will be built on adjacent islands, Children?s Bay Cay and Williams Cay, off the northern tip of Great Exuma near the settlement of Barraterre.

Grand Isle Plans Restaurant Revamp
The multi-million-dollar Grand Isle Resort, located on Emerald Bay, Exuma, will undergo major construction and renovations once its doors are closed temporarily, beginning next month.
